vimarsana.com
Home
Sivaganga Network Local Business
Top Locations Tagged with Sivaganga Network Local Business
Sivaganga Network Local Business in India - 630001/Local-business near Sivaganga
1). Royal Network System Karaikkudi India
vimarsana © 2020. All Rights Reserved.